Preguntas frecuentes: It's all good vs No problem vs No worries
¿Cuál es la diferencia entre It's all good, No problem y No worries?
It's all good: Everything is fine or okay. No problem: It's okay; there is no issue. No worries: Don't worry or be anxious.
¿Puedes mostrar un ejemplo de cada una?
It's all good: After the misunderstanding, she smiled and said, 'It's all good.' No problem: If you need help, just ask! No problem at all! No worries: You forgot your notebook? No worries, you can borrow mine.
¿Puedo usar It's all good, No problem y No worries indistintamente?
No siempre. It's all good, No problem y No worries están relacionadas y a veces se solapan, pero difieren en registro, frecuencia y uso, así que cambiar una por otra puede alterar el significado o el tono. Revisa las diferencias de arriba antes de sustituir.
